Tel Aviv attack

While the Palestinians celebrate the latest terror attack, this time in Tel Aviv, Israel mourns the four innocent civilians who were murdered by the terrorists.

The Israelis murdered by two Palestinian terrorists on Wednesday night in Tel Aviv are Ido Ben Aryeh, 42, from Ramat Gan, Ilana Nave, 39, from Tel Aviv, Dr. Michael Fayge, 58, from Ramat Gan and Mila Mishayev, 32, from Rishon LeZion.

Ben Ari, a veteran of the elite Sayeret Matkal Unit, was sitting with his wife and two children when he was murdered. His wife, Tal, was wounded as well. She underwent an operation and is currently hospitalized.

Ben Ari received a special commendation for his exemplary military service. His organs were donated after his death.

Dr. Fayge, a sociologist and anthropologist, was the head of the Israel Studies Department at Ben Gurion University at Beer Sheva. He is survived by a wife and three daughters.

Mishayev’s family, which emigrated from the former Soviet Union, is reportedly in a dire emotional state, and the local municipality is lending social support. She is survived by her two parents, two brothers and a sister. She had plans to get married in the near future.

Ilana Naveh is survived by her husband and four daughters.

Seventeen other victims were wounded in the attack.
